有没有办法使用CreateParams的覆盖将Window样式更改为none?

时间:2015-05-17 06:11:45

标签: c# .net styles window createparams

我正在尝试创建窗口样式设置为“无”的应用程序。据我所知,我可以使用CreateParams的覆盖来改变样式和扩展样式:

protected override CreateParams CreateParams
        {
            get
            {
                var cp = base.CreateParams;
                //cp.Style |= ???
                cp.ExStyle |= 0x80;  // Turn on WS_EX_TOOLWINDOW
                return cp;
            }
        }

我使用ExStyle作为0x80,以便应用程序不显示在任务栏或任务管理器中。为了将窗口样式更改为None,我还应该使用什么?我根据List of Styles无法理解使用什么样的风格。

0 个答案:

没有答案